Reachin' All Around is the tenth album by Thelma Houston released in 1982. The album consists of previously unreleased material recorded while at Motown Records. While the album did not become a major seller, it is well liked by her fans. This album has yet to be reissued on CD.

Track listing

  1. "You Were Never My Friend" (Charles Kipps, Van McCoy)
  2. "Reachin' All Around My Love" (Larry Brown, Terri McFaddin)
  3. "I Can't Go Home Again" (Ron Miller)
  4. "Lies" (Larry Brown, Terri McFaddin)
  5. "Don't Wonder Why" (Leonard Caston)
  6. "I Never Took No For An Answer" (Mitchell Botler, Norma Helms)
  7. "Rhythm of Love" (Kathy Wakefield, Ken Hirsch)
  8. "(I've Given You) The Best Years of My Life" (Dino Fekaris, Jack Goga, Nick Zesses)
  9. "A Little Bit A Heaven and A Little Bit A Hell" (Deirdre Meehan, Michael Masser)
  10. Medley:"Stormy Weather"/"I Can't Stand The Rain" (Harold Arlen, Ted Koehler/Ann Peebles, Bernard Miller, Don Bryant)
